DOT is not good enough for AutoX, has to be M rating or better.
SA is the 'road racer' rating. Should be good for any track. Pay attention to the year too, tracks usually want a newer rating than autoX accepts.

SA 2005 is the latest rating.
Snell rated is the minimum for Solo racing and allows Snell 95 and later helmets, so 95, 2000, 2005; SCCA Club Racing requires Snell 2000 and later helmets, so 2000 and 2005. SA helmets have a nomex lining, smaller eyeport and different impact testing than M-rated helmets.
